Dem Rep. Defends Party Chaos, Promises More of the Same

Democratic Rep. Jake Auchincloss went on Fox’s Big Weekend Show this week and tried to put a brave face on his party’s collapse, pledging to “disrupt the status quo” and touting piecemeal fixes for America’s broken healthcare market. His words came after a humiliating shutdown spectacle that left millions of Americans scrambling and the Democratic brand bruised beyond repair.

The shutdown that Auchincloss was asked to defend wasn’t a minor skirmish — it became the longest in our nation’s history and only finally ended when Congress moved to reopen the government in mid-November, after weeks of lost paychecks, canceled flights, and real economic pain for ordinary families. Americans watching their neighbors and federal workers suffer deserve more than political theater; they deserve leaders who put country over caucus.

Instead of honest accountability, Democrats responded with internecine bickering and public recrimination, with moderates openly breaking ranks and party leaders facing a stampede of criticism. The fissures are plain: some House Democrats voted to end the shutdown and reopen the government while others clung to intransigent demands, exposing a party more interested in messaging than solving problems.

Auchincloss’s healthcare promises sound familiar — calls to tinker and expand more taxpayer subsidies — but this was the very issue that helped fuel the shutdown fight in the first place, as Democrats dug in over expiring Affordable Care Act premium tax credits. Voters remember that these debates threw coverage costs into chaos and nearly left families paying even higher premiums this fall.

The American people were not impressed when Washington’s gamesmanship dragged on while breadwinners missed paychecks and essential services faltered; thankfully, lawmakers finally passed a funding bill and put an end to the chaos so people could get back to work and Thanksgiving could be salvaged for millions.
